Color consulting in Cumming, GA typically costs between $200 and $500 per job. Prices are primarily influenced by the consultant's experience and the scope of the project, such as whether it's for a single room or an entire house.

Color consultants typically charge either an hourly rate or a flat fee per project. Hourly rates can range from $15 to $200, depending on their experience, while project-based fees often fall between $200 and $500 for a typical residential consultation.
Key factors influencing cost include the scope of the project (e.g., single room vs. multiple rooms or an entire house), the consultant's level of experience and reputation, whether the service is hourly or project-based, and the specific deliverables included in the consultation.
For larger or more complex projects, an experienced color consultant (who may charge $150-$200 per hour) can offer significantly more expertise, a broader understanding of color theory, and a proven track record, potentially leading to a more cohesive and satisfactory outcome that justifies the higher cost.
Yes, some painting companies in the Cumming, GA, area, such as Mendez Painting and Bear Mountain Custom Painting, offer standalone color consulting services. These can sometimes be integrated into a larger painting project or hired independently.
Sherwin-Williams offers a free virtual color consultation service. This can be a cost-effective option for clients, though it differs from the more personalized, on-site services provided by independent consultants who typically charge $99/hour or $200-$500 per job.
